Exciting Earnings Events for Technology Giants

In the coming weeks, we can expect to see earnings reports from some of the largest players in the tech industry, including Microsoft, Tesla, Meta Platforms, Apple, Alphabet, and Amazon. Collectively known as the 'Magnificent 7,' these companies hold significant sway over market sentiment, given their staggering combined market capitalization of approximately $14.5 trillion.

Analysts project these companies will reveal an average revenue growth of around 10.3% year-over-year, paired with a notably positive outlook in the tech sector. With such substantial figures on the table, the forthcoming reports promise to offer vital insights into the health of the tech landscape and the broader economic climate.

Key Factors to Watch

As these tech behemoths prepare to disclose their earnings, investors will pay close attention to how these companies manage to balance their growth investments with operational efficiency. In particular, the focus will be on their strategies related to artificial intelligence (AI) advancements and cloud infrastructure development.

For instance, Microsoft's Copilot initiative and Meta's investment in AI infrastructure are expected to be key talking points. Google will also be in the spotlight for updates regarding its Gemini AI platform, which aims to keep the company competitive in the ever-evolving tech sector.

Equally important is the performance of their cloud computing segments. Services like Microsoft Azure, Amazon Web Services (AWS), and Google Cloud are critical as businesses increasingly embrace digital transformation. Investors will want to grasp how these entities are capitalizing on their cloud services to accelerate growth.

Furthermore, the state of the digital advertising domain will be closely monitored, particularly for Meta, Alphabet, and Amazon, as their ad segments play a crucial role in capturing consumer spending and reflecting economic trends.

A Closer Look at Earnings Projections

The anticipated earnings for these tech titans are as follows:

  • Microsoft: Expected EPS of $3.13 (+6.6% YoY) and revenue of $68.82 billion (+10.9% YoY).
  • Tesla: Predicted revenue of $27.07 billion (+7.5% YoY) with an EPS forecast drop to $0.76 (-66.7% YoY).
  • Meta Platforms: Anticipated EPS of $6.73 (+30.7% YoY) and revenue of $46.96 billion (+17.2% YoY).
  • Apple: Projected revenue at $124.1 billion (+4.0% YoY) and EPS of $2.35 (+8.4% YoY).
  • Alphabet: EPS set at $2.12 (+30.5% YoY) with revenue of $96.6 billion (+12.0% YoY).
  • Amazon: Estimated revenue of $187.3 billion (+10.2% YoY) and EPS of $1.48 (+50.4% YoY).

Company Financial Insights

Each company’s earnings release will likely reveal not only how they performed but also their strategies going forward. A crucial aspect of these reports will be their Financial Health Scores, helping investors gauge the companies' overall financial wellbeing and sustainability.

For this earnings season, Alphabet appears to lead with a commendable Financial Health Score of 3.32, reflecting its robust financial position. In contrast, Apple shows the lowest score at 2.63, indicating potential challenges ahead.
